The elastoplastic deformation of spherical shells of uniform thickness acted upon by external pressure is investigated in this paper. A deformation theory of plasticity is combined with the classical elasticity equations and a solution is obtained by the method of successive elastic solutions. A logarithmic effective stress-effective plastic strain diagram is used to determine the volume change for thick polypropylene spheres under the action of external pressure. These results are compared with previously published experimental volume changes in polypropylene spheres. This comparison shows that the predicted volume changes are similar to the experimental results.
